Kishore Gaddam is the CEO and a co-founder of Astrani Technologies and is recognized as an industry expert in mobile, cloud, and bot software development. He is a forward-thinking technology leader with 17+ years of international experience in building technology organizations, strategic planning, rolling out multiple platforms/products, IT program and project management, strategy and transformation (businesses, people, processes, and technologies), and growing business units across IoT, smart cities, NLP, AI, bots, cloud, robotics, mobile, healthcare, industrial automation, financial systems, retail, procurement (EPC), travel & leisure, logistics, manufacturing, and automotive domains.
He is a champion of the technical pre-sales, architecture, and software development of enterprise Azure IoT/bot/web applications using cognitive services, microservices, Service Fabric, Azure IoT Hub, Stream Analytics, Cortana Intelligence Suit, Logic Apps, Notification Hubs, Big Data, Azure Web Apps, Azure App service, Azure API Apps, Application Insights, API Management, Machine Learning, Azure SQL databases, Cosmos DB, Data Factory, Data Lake, HD Insight, Redis Cache, Key Vault, and Azure Service Bus, and a champion of implementing DevOps using Azure, PowerShell scripts, ARM templates, and VSTS. He has huge experience in startup leadership, including building teams, and developing a Minimum Viable Product (MVP) with little to no supervision. Kishore is comfortable at all layers of the startup people stack, from individual contributor (software development, product management) to CxO.
Kishore graduated in Technology Entrepreneurship from Stanford University, CA, and is a speaker at various conferences in the USA. Kishore is the author of the popular Microsoft Technologies blog. He has a love for mentoring and a passion for sharing new tools, programming languages, and technology trends at national conferences, regional code camps, local user groups, meetups, and hackathons.
